Transaction 8c6fc938af44471205dfe1ec20a628357f3190d83df45c493e2dc81bbd5a14b4
1 Input
1 Output
-
8c6fc938af44471205dfe1ec20a628357f3190d83df45c493e2dc81bbd5a14b4:0
- value
- 32446
- script pubkey
- OP_0 OP_PUSHBYTES_20 d90530e64cd5fdfa5253b022da5905b4124ad0c2
- address
- bc1qmyznpejv6h7l55jnkq3d5kg9ksfy45xzed3way